Hidden Family Pests
Are you knowledgeable about the covert family pests that may be hiding in your home? While you might be vigilant regarding typical pests like ants or crawlers, there are various other stealthy burglars that could be triggering harm behind the scenes.
One such pest is the silverfish, a small insect that grows in moist and dark atmospheres like basements and shower rooms. These insects can harm publications, clothing, and also wallpaper, making them a hassle to handle.
An additional concealed insect to keep an eye out for is the carpeting beetle. These tiny insects prey on a range of products located in homes, such as rugs, clothing, and upholstery. Their larvae can trigger considerable damages if left unchecked, making it crucial to address any signs of invasion immediately.
In addition, mold and mildew mites are typically ignored however can indicate a moisture issue in your home. These small creatures feed on mold and mildew and can worsen allergic reactions for sensitive people.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can aid stop these bugs from taking up residence in your space.
Remain attentive and attend to any indicators of these hidden home bugs to maintain your home pest-free.
Unwelcome Intruders
Unwanted trespassers can disrupt your house tranquility and cause damages otherwise handled without delay. While pests like rodents and cockroaches are typically understood, other lesser-known burglars like silverfish and carpet beetles can likewise create chaos in your house. Silverfish are tiny, wingless insects that grow in damp areas and prey on starchy products like paper and adhesive, triggering damage to books, wallpaper, and clothes. Rug beetles, on the other hand, feast on a range of items such as carpets, clothing, and upholstery, leading to expensive damage if left unchecked.
These unwanted burglars not just harm your personal belongings but can likewise posture health threats. Rats and roaches, as an example, can spread diseases with their droppings and pee, polluting surface areas and food. Silverfish and carpeting beetles can set off allergic reactions in some individuals, bring about skin irritation and respiratory issues.
